English (Traduisez ce texte en Français): you can not straighten out of the drop of this wave on most size days (if its bigger, it breaks clear of the headland) and you have to be pretty quick even though its sweden and usually small, the rocks are right inside. But, if you make the drop and pull in, then it is one of the few places where you can get barreled here.

English (Traduisez ce texte en Français): its a beautiful beach with an obvious wave, if you are lucky the wind will be blowing so hard on a not direct angle and then the wave can be clean. the locals are real scared of this place turning into a version of åsa so might not be too friendly about you showing up, so never bring a camera and don't give out directions to the spot.they will know its you

English (Traduisez ce texte en Français): do not show up with a crowd here, i was shown this place by an american surfer a few years back, it cannot hold alot of people and you can't see your car from the break. if you do show up, you may need to promise the other surfers not to give directions to the spot, they will ask you how you found it. it's also close to a city so there is an overcrowding potential. if you do show up though, just don't drop in, or be in the way and you should be fine, you have every right to surf that spots especially because it is a law in sweden called 'allemänsrätten' which means the land is everyones.
